You can gather evidence with the help of these tools
A lawyer will work closely with experts to collect evidence, and create a clear understanding of what transpired and the person who caused the incident. They will review police reports and medical records, photos and other physical evidence, and eyewitness statements to build a compelling case for you. They are aware of how insurance companies work and how to negotiate on your behalf.
Physical evidence could include skid marks on the road, damage to your vehicle, or even a broken streetlight. A skilled accident reconstruction expert can make use of these evidences to prove fault. They can also speak to eyewitnesses in order to get their first-hand account of the incident. These statements are vital because they provide an unbiased view of the events that took place. They'll also call in experts as witnesses, like medical professionals who can detail the consequences of your injuries to help them build an argument for you.

Documentation is crucial to establishing your injuries. It's crucial that you record all relevant information as soon as you can after an accident. It's not always simple to do but you can start by keeping a log of your pain level and any emotional trauma that was caused by the accident. You should also visit your physician for a comprehensive health checkup and detailed document of all the injuries you sustained. These medical records will help strengthen your case for future treatment and any future damages. In certain situations, your attorney may advise you to seek psychological assessments or testimonies from your loved ones that can support your claims of non-economic damages, such as pain and suffering.

The first step is to calculate how much your claim is worth. This is done by evaluating your injuries, what medical treatment you have needed and will need in the future, and how much your car is worth, when it was destroyed or damaged following the accident, and any other losses that have occurred as a result the accident. Your lawyer can incorporate these numbers into demand letters and discuss the matter with the insurance company.

When choosing an attorney, it is important to think about their reputation, experience, staffing, location, and fee structure. Some attorneys offer free consultations, while others require retainers. Others will only accept payment only if they are successful in your case. Ask them how many cases they handle every day, their success rate, and how long they've been in practice. You should also find out whether they belong to any professional organizations, and if they teach or lecture at seminars on legal education.

A lawyer can help you file an accident claim, which can be done through the insurance company that is at fault or your own. The lawyer will also keep track of any deadlines and ensure that the process is proceeding as expected.
If the insurance coverage of the driver at fault is not enough to compensate you for all your economic losses as well as non-economic damages (such as pain and suffering), then you may have to bring a lawsuit against them. This is a typical situation when the victim's injuries or expenses are significant.
